I read on another forum where they had a problem with some of their Brake Mechanisms failing.
"Easy fix. Just take 3 screws out from the side of the motor and the unit comes right off. The brake is added so that the bedlocker stays locked in-place once the pressure sensor shuts off the motor. Without it, the cover may activate with vibration of the moving vehicle."

Pace Edwards BedLocker Tonneau Cover - BL2078 will not open or close using the remote. I can hear clicking like on & off but no movement. Work great moving it by hand with brake released.

Funny, I thought this question had two answers? One was by the Indian AI Answer Bot Raja Akhter since deleted and another poster who said the brake was in the rear bed front left hand side. Not a lot of use as you said it works with the brake released.

You say you are getting no response. I always find it is better to phone. Speak to a real person in Support / R&D. It sounds like you have a relay problem. The clicking it the relay trying to switch power to the motor.

The phone number is at the bottom of the page. How old it is? Under warranty? The warranty is 7 years. What did the local dealer say?

Chevy idle problems

Biggest problem that I have found with these motors concerning idle is a dirty throttle body plate. Get some carb cleaner open the butterfly, spray it grab a rag and clean out as much of the black residue you can. Don't spray to much Down intake. May backfire. You can spray the rag down and work it back and forth. Hope this helps

My Toro Personal Pace 22"

pull your spark plug and see if it will pull then, if so then it is hydro locked with fuel which can be caused y a bad fuel cap, not venting or a stuck open needle in carb causing gas to flood cylinder

I have installed a pace Edwards jack rabbit roll up toneau cover on a 07 tundra. The mounting clamps are attached at the front of the rail near the canister and about 8" from the tailgate. The problem...

As you may be aware, the knob has to be rotated to pull in the latches so you can open the top. When you pull on the strap to close the top, I releases the latches so they will stop at the 1 ft intervals.

1. Make sure that when you pull on the strap, you see the knob pop back to the lock position (handle going side to side) If it stays in a front to back orientation, the strap is not pulling on the latch release.
2. On either side of the roll top, there is a plastic block that keeps the latch bars in place. If one of the screws falls out, you will lose control of the latch on that side so it no longer locks the cover at any of the intervals.

I've had a jackrabbit cover for the past 8 years and I've only had a couple little issues related to the latching. The things i indicated are what I found to be the problem at different times.
